Machrihanish and Machrie Logistic advice???


hammergolf

Recommended Posts

Doing the preliminary planning for my solo Scotland trip in October. Have most of it pretty well laid out except for Machrihanish and Machrie. Easy to get to either one via cheap and quick flight from Glasgow. However, looking like a nightmare getting from one to the other. There is no direct flight from one to the other, only a connection that goes back through Glasgow and takes 8.5 hours which basically wastes a day. I’ve looked at taking a ferry from Port Ellen to Campbeltown but struggling to find a rental car at Glenegedale and drop off in Campbeltown it vice versa. Anyone have any advice?

Hammergolf

 

Not a bad schedule

 

To get in Machrie I would try the following

 

Day 7 play Dornoch

Drive to Oban

 

Day 8 play Machrihanish 

catch ferry from Kennacraig to Islay

 

Day 9 play Machrie

catch ferry back to Kennacraig stay Machrihanish

 

Day 10 play Mach Dunes

Drive to Ayr

 

Hope this gives you some ideas

I did fall into the 'Rota trap' and played mostly the 'big' courses, but at that time, I thought it was going to my 'once in a lifetime' trip. Circumstances have changed and I am lucky to be able to plan more trips in the future. After covid finishes messing up everyone's world I will be back. I will say this, try to play each course twice because you won't remember much - seeing as that you have such a big list, at least try.

The courses I played

Carnoustie (4 rounds)

Dornoch (4)

Troon (1)

Turnberry (1)

Prestwick (2)

Gullane (1)

North Berwick (1)

Crail (1)

Castle & Kingsbarn (1)

Jubilee (1)

New Course (1)

Old course (6)

It would be unfair to pick one as my favourite but I will say that the courses I was lucky to have played more than once, I can still visualize all the holes. And sadly the ones I only played once, I can barely remember more than a few holes, it's like I never played them😞 As for the Old course, I did the waiting in line at 2am, hence the 6 rounds. My next trip, I will be getting a membership and play out of one course. I have no desire to do 'drive by' rota courses anymore. The old course will also hold a special place in my heart because of the history, but the place is so busy (not complaining because that spirit is amazing) I'd rather blend into a city/town. The plan for the following summer is the be at Murcar and from there explore the northeast and maybe head back down to Fife. 

Those are just my thoughts. Again, your trip sounds AMAZING because there are some 'off the grid' courses - Machrie and Machrihanish. I'd look at those two and perhaps even Askernish on the following trip.🙂
